
5-Amino-1MQ
A small-molecule NNMT inhibitor studied for NAD+ salvage and adipocyte metabolism.
Research Overview
5-Amino-1MQ is a small-molecule inhibitor of nicotinamide N-methyltransferase (NNMT), an enzyme that methylates nicotinamide. By inhibiting NNMT, research models report increased availability of nicotinamide for NAD+ salvage and altered S-adenosylmethionine (SAM) flux.
It is studied particularly in adipocyte metabolic models for its effects on cellular energy metabolism. Note: this is a small molecule, not a peptide.
